Cooking 2 years About tuition

General Cooking Course (2 years)
Japanese Sushi Class/Western Cooking Class

Course Fees
1st grade 2st grade
Enrollment fee 250,000JPY
Tuition 760,000JPY 760,000JPY
Training fee 710,000JPY 930,000JPY
Facility management fee 100,000JPY 100,000JPY
total 1,820,000JPY 1,790,000JPY
About overseas training

There is a system called "overseas training scholarship" that supports the cost of "overseas training" that is carried out while in school so that you can study with a broad perspective. (No repayment required)
All applicants are eligible, so everyone has the chance to study abroad.
*The cost of the overseas training scholarship will be covered by a portion of the sales from the shop, cafe, and restaurant training conducted both on and off campus.
<Amount of Grant> Overseas training expensesPartial payment(The amount of the grant varies depending on the year.)
<Target> All students enrolled in 2nd or 3rd year classes

Remarks
  1. In addition to tuition fees, you will need to pay miscellaneous expenses of approximately 1 yen per year in the first year and approximately 23 yen per year in the second year.*Prices may change due to materials.
    Miscellaneous expenses include textbook fees, training uniforms, knife sets, extracurricular activity fees, etc.
  2. The number of practical training hours per year is about twice the prescribed number of hours.All food costs are included in the above "training fee", so there is no additional cost collection.
  3. Lunch is provided on regular school days.You don't have to pay every time.(Due to school events and timetables, there may be some days when the service is not available.)
